Actress Arrested for Allegedly Stalking Alec Baldwin

An actress who once worked on the 2002 movie "The Adventures of Pluto Nash," in which Alec Baldwin had a cameo role, was arrested in New York on Sunday night for allegedly showing up at his Manhattan apartment and stalking him, reports the New York Post.

Canadian actress Genevieve Sabourin, 40, was charged with aggravated harassment and stalking.

Baldwin was in Long Island at the time and when the doorman called to report the woman at his apartment, he contacted the police. Sabourin had reportedly previously harassed Baldwin in his Hamptons home on March 31, prompting the actor to file a complaint with the police.

Sabourin has allegedly been sending emails and text messages to Baldwin saying she loves him and wants to have his baby — and also saying she needs money, according to the report.

She is listed as unit publicist on "Pluto Nash."
